Solution for 24+3y-6=13y-12-5y equation:



24+3y-6=13y-12-5y
We move all terms to the left:
24+3y-6-(13y-12-5y)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3y-(8y-12)+24-6=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3y-(8y-12)+18=0
We get rid of parentheses
3y-8y+12+18=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-5y+30=0
We move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right
-5y=-30
y=-30/-5
y=+6
